What is Sales Tax Calculator?

A sales tax calculator computes total purchase price including state and local sales tax based on item price and applicable tax rate. Sales tax ranges from 0% (Alaska, Delaware, Montana, New Hampshire, Oregon have no state sales tax) to 9.56% in Tennessee (state+local combined), with most states 6-8%. Formula: Price × (1 + Tax Rate) = Total. Also calculates tax amount separately, or reverses to find pre-tax price from total. Essential for shoppers budgeting purchases, retailers pricing products, online sellers calculating tax obligations, and anyone buying/selling goods requiring sales tax collection.

Key Benefits & Use Cases

Budget accurately by knowing true purchase cost including tax—$2,000 laptop actually costs $2,200 in 10% sales tax area. Retailers set competitive pricing by calculating pre-tax price that results in attractive total: want $99.99 after-tax price in 7% area, need to price product at $93.45 pre-tax. Online sellers comply with economic nexus laws requiring tax collection in states where you exceed $100,000 sales or 200 transactions—calculate correct rates for each state. Compare prices across locations: $1,000 TV in Oregon ($0 tax) versus Washington (10.4% combined tax = $1,104) shows $104 savings buying across border. Understand deductible business expenses: sales tax on business purchases often deductible, increasing true cost of equipment. Calculate cost basis correctly for accounting and tax purposes.

How to Use This Calculator

Enter item price (pre-tax amount) and sales tax rate percentage for your location (state + local combined rate). Calculator shows total price including tax and tax amount separately. Find local rate using ZIP code lookup tools (TaxJar, Avalara) as rates vary by city and county within states. For multiple items: calculate subtotal of all items, then apply tax once to subtotal. Reverse calculate: enter total paid amount and tax rate to find pre-tax price—useful for expense reporting or determining merchant pricing. Online sellers use automated tax calculation services (Shopify Tax, TaxJar, Avalara) that handle 12,000+ US tax jurisdictions. For tax-exempt purchases (resale, nonprofit, government), provide exemption certificate to seller.
